Two people were shot in the Little Village neighborhood Friday night.

Two men, both 20, were in the 2500 block of South California about 9 p.m. when two other males walked up and shot them, police said.

Both were taken to Mount Sinai Hospital, police said. One man was shot in the left leg and the other in the right leg. Their conditions had stabilized.
